Abstract
A rotating electric machine, which can achieve improvement of a reluctance torque, reduction of stress and improvement of a power factor at the same time, and can also realize high output, and an electrically driven vehicle having the rotating electric machine are provided. A permanent magnet is arranged on a q-axis that connects magnetic poles of a rotor; a gap is formed in a radial direction of the permanent magnet; another permanent magnet is arranged facing the said permanent magnet so that these permanent magnets may sandwich a d-axis which connects centers of the magnetic poles; and another gap is formed at a position corresponding to a position of the said gap. Further, a first virtual line that coincides with a boundary of a permanent magnet insertion hole, which is arranged facing the d-axis, on an inner circumference side of a rotor core; and a second virtual line that is concentric with an inner circumference of the rotor core and contacts the first vertical line are set so that the second virtual line on the innermost circumference and the first virtual line have two or more tangent points.
